YCrCb420ToRGB

Converts a YCrCb image with the 4:2:0 sampling to the RGB image.

Syntax

IppStatus, ippiYCrCb420ToRGB_8u_P3C4R,(const Ipp8u* pSrc[3],int srcStep[3], Ipp8u* pDst, int dstStep, IppiSize roiSize, Ipp8u aval);

Parameters

pSrc

An array of pointers to ROI in separate planes of the source image.

srcStep

An array of distances in bytes between starts of consecutive lines in the source image planes.

pDst

Pointer to the destination image ROI.

dstStep

Distance in bytes between starts of consecutive lines in the destination image.

roiSize

Size of the source and destination ROI in pixels.

aval

Constant value to create fourth channel.

Description

The function ippiYCrCb420ToRGB is declared in the ippcc.h file. It operates with ROI (see Regions of Interest in Intel IPP).

This function converts the Y'Cr'Cb' image pSrc with the 4:2:0 sampling (see Table “Planar Image Formats” for more details) to the four-channel gamma-corrected R'G'B' image pDst according to the same formulas as the function ippiYCbCrToRGB does.

Fourth channel is created by setting channel values to the constant value aval.

roiSize.width and roiSize.height should be multiples of 2. If not the function reduces their original values to the nearest multiples of 2, performs the operation, and returns a warning message.

Return Values

ippStsNoErr

Indicates no error. Any other value indicates an error or a warning.

ippStsNullPtrErr

Indicates an error condition if pSrc or pDst is NULL.

ippStsSizeErr

Indicates an error condition if roiSize has a field with a zero or negative value.

ippStsDoubleSize

Indicates a warning if roiSize has a field that is not a multiple of 2.
